Culinary Offerings

Alongside the pottery-making experience, the Italian Tastings & Pottery Workshop offers a delightful culinary component.

The aperitivo features a selection of Roman specialties, including:

  • Supplì – a fried rice croquette
  • Bruschetta – toasted bread topped with tomatoes and herbs
  • Mini sandwiches

Plus, the spread includes local cheeses, biscuits with jam, and refreshments such as juices, soft drinks, and pizza al taglio.
